jquery对象声明 jquery对象声明符号
jQuery里的var声明带$和不带$有啥区别?
1、没有区别,只是习惯。 一般在给jquery对象取名的时候在前面加$。 一看就知道是jquery对象。变量命名规则中起始字符可以是 字母,下划线(_),美元符($),只是很多的js库喜欢使用$作为全局变量标志。
网站设计制作过程拒绝使用模板建站;使用PHP+MYSQL原生开发可交付网站源代码;符合网站优化排名的后台管理系统;成都网站建设、网站建设收费合理;免费进行网站备案等企业网站建设一条龙服务.我们是一家持续稳定运营了10余年的成都创新互联公司网站建设公司。
2、let声明的变量有块作用域的概念,而var声明的变量没有块作用域的概念,在块作用域外也可以使用。let和var在重新声明变量时,有所不同。
3、变量中可以出现 $符号、 一般jquery 中 会用$符号开头定义变量,用于区别该变量是jquery的变量还是其他变量。
4、一般是用jquery变量前边加$,用来区别js变量。代码很复杂,变量很多的话,通过名字就能分辨出是js变量还是jquery变量。
5、没有任何区别。在JQuery或是JS里面,和“” 的作用是一模一样的。就是在输入的时候,一个直接输入,一个还有按着shift键。见此而已。
6、(function(){a=1})();alert(a);alert(window.a);最后的结果就是 他们都是同样的 js中 允许在定义变量的时候 不加var 修饰符。
jquery怎么给对象定义自定义方法啊?
比如定义的方法如下:function objectClass(){ alert(这是自己定义的方法);} 调用这个方法:function useObjectClass(){ objectClass();} 那么当事件触发useObjectClass()方法时,就会调用objectClass()方法了。
jQuery提供一些方法(如:toggle)将两种事件效果合并到一起,比如:mouseover、mouseout;keyup、keydown等hover函数hover(over,out)一个模仿悬停事件(鼠标移动到一个对象上面及移出这个对象)的方法。
如何开始使用 首先用$.widget()方法开始定义你的组件,它只接收三个参数:第一个是组件名称,第二个是可选的基类组件(默认的基类是$.Widget),第三个是组件的原型。
jQuery与DOM对象有什么区别以及如何转换
1、由于jquery对象本身是一个集合。所以如果jquery对象要转换为dom对象则必须取出其中的某一项,一般可通过索引取出。
2、深刻了解jQuery对象和普通DOM对象的区别。
3、jQuery对象就是通过jQuery包装DOM对象后产生的对象。
4、DOM对象就是Javascript 固有的一些对象操作。DOM 对象能使用Javascript 固有的方法,但是不能使用 jQuery 里的方法。
DOM对象与jquery对象有什么不同
jQuery的$(document)对象是jQuery自定义的对象,就是在js原生的document对象外面再套一层“壳”,添加了自身的一些属性、方法、事件等。所以两者是不相同的。
jQuery对象是一个数组对象,可以通过[index]的方法得到相应的DOM对象。
jQuery对象与dom对象的转换 只有jquery对象才能使用jquery定义的方法。注意dom对象和jquery对象是有区别的,调用方法时要注意操作的是dom对象还是jquery对象。普通的dom对象一般可以通过$()转换成jquery对象。
JavaScript 对象JavaScript 提供多个内建对象,比如 String、Date、Array 等等。对象只是带有属性和方法的特殊数据类型。
名称栏目:jquery对象声明 jquery对象声明符号
标题链接:http://myzitong.com/article/dgeehgo.html